If there are supply issues allowing spikes on the power rails, perhaps
the PSU capacitors are
ageing.....getting on for 30 years if they are original, I had one
when Roland first released them
(82 or 83 ?). Try a scope on the rails to check.

> I've owned a few of these - if there are any power issues, the board
> will reset to the manual patch - sometimes it is external - like
> having a space heater plugged into the same outlet.
